The defense language institute categorizes languages into four levels of difficulty. Category i languages are easier to pick up, while moving on up through category iv, language comprehension is more difficult, and the length of courses reflect that. Category i languages, 26-week courses, include spanish, french, italian and portuguese.

The egyptian language belongs to the afroasiatic language family. Among the typological features of egyptian that are typically afroasiatic are its fusional morphology, nonconcatenative morphology, a series of emphatic consonants, a three-vowel system /a i u/, nominal feminine suffix *-at, nominal m-, adjectival *-ī and characteristic personal verbal affixes.
